英文摘要Multiple functionalized arenes are irreplaceable part of numerous bioactive natural products and pharmaceuticals. Transition-metal-catalyzed direct unsymmetrical twofold or multiple C-H bonds functionalization was highly desirable but less explored. Herein, we have developed a Rh(III)-catalyzed unsymmetrical C-H alkenylation-annulation/amidation reaction with a O-bearing olefin-tethered arenes, enabling delivery of diverse furoquinazolinones in one step with broad substrate scope and good functional group tolerance.
